Hydraulic uid cooler
The oil radiator is installed behind the diesel engine (Fig. 82).
The left part contains hydraulic oil; the right part is intended
for cooling for the engine. Should the loader get too hot dur-
ing long drives on the road or at high outside temperatures,
check whether the fan‘s V-belt is taut and in good condition
and whether the radiator air ow is blocked.
Ventilation lter / hydraulic uidller neck
The ventilation lter is located on the hydraulic uid reser-
voir item 1 (Fig. 83). It ensures that the hydraulic reservoir
is ventilated and exhausted when the hydraulic uid level
uctuates. The air lter contains a lter element which pre-
vents dust and dirt from penetrating and oil spillings from
escaping. The air lter has a valve that keeps the reservoir
pressure at approx. 0.5 bar (7 psi). This pressure will escape
if the hydraulic uid ller neck is opened.
Replace the ventilation lter after 1000 operating
hours.
